E-couponing
First Claim
1. A method of handling electronic coupons, the method comprising:
- accessing information indicating association of an electronic coupon with an account of a user of an electronic coupon system, the account including information identifying a first retail entity associated with the user and a second retail entity associated with the user, wherein the second retail entity is different than the first retail entity;
transmitting information indicating association of the electronic coupon with the user'"'"'s account to a first computer system associated with the first retail entity, wherein receipt of the information indicating association of the electronic coupon by the first computer system causes the first computer system to associate the electronic coupon with the user such that the user may redeem the electronic coupon at a retail store associated with the first retail entity upon presentation of a first user identifier;
transmitting information indicating association of the electronic coupon with the user'"'"'s account to a second computer system associated with the second retail entity, wherein the second computer system is different from the first computer system and receipt of the information indicating association of the electronic coupon by the second computer system causes the second computer system to associate the electronic coupon with the user such that the user may redeem the electronic coupon at a retail store associated with the second retail entity upon presentation of a second user identifier;
receiving, from the first computer system, information indicating that the user has redeemed the electronic coupon at a retail store associated with the first retail entity; and
in response to receiving, from the first computer system, the information indicating that the user has redeemed the electronic coupon at the retail store associated with the first retail entity, transmitting cancellation information for the electronic coupon to the second computer system associated with the second retail entity, wherein receipt of the cancellation information by the second computer system causes the second computer system to cancel the redeemability of the electronic coupon by the user such that the user is prevented from redeeming the electronic coupon at a retail store associated with the second retail entity.

Abstract
Handling electronic coupons includes accessing information indicating association of an electronic coupon with an account of a user that identifies multiple retail entities associated with the user. Information indicating association of electronic coupons with the user'"'"'s account may be transmitted to respective computer systems associated with the multiple retail entities. The computer systems may associate electronic coupons with the user such that the user may redeem the electronic coupons at a retail store upon presentation of a user identifier. When the user redeems an electronic coupon, cancellation information for the electronic coupon may be transmitted to the computer systems of other retail entities associated with the user. Receipt of the cancellation information may cause the respective computer systems to cancel the redeemability of the electronic coupon such that the user is prevented from redeeming the electronic coupon at a retail store associated with the corresponding retail entity.
